GIRALDO v. MORRISEY


63 A.D.3d 784 (2009)

880 N.Y.S.2d 512

ROSE GIRALDO, Respondent, v. THOMAS MORRISEY et al., Appellants.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ided June 9, 2009.


Ordered that the appeal by the defendant Melissa Morrisey from the judgment insofar as against her is dismissed, as she is not aggrieved thereby (see CPLR 5511); and it is further,

Ordered that the judgment insofar as against the defendant Thomas Morrisey is affirmed; and it is further,

Ordered that one bill of costs is awarded to the plaintiff.
